Pam studied physical therapy at Russell Sage College in New York. She fell in love with an Army officer and spent the next several years practicing physical therapy throughout the U.S. and Germany. Along the way she received special training in Neuro-Developmental techniques for children and became certified in Neuro-Developmental Techniques – Pediatric. She previously worked in a pediatric hospital treating children with orthopedic, neurologic and developmental conditions. Pam has extensive amount of teaching to physical therapy students about pediatric practice. She has been motivated to take a variety of continuing education courses which is highlighted by her recent graduation with a doctorate in physical therapy from the University of Texas Medical Branch in Galveston.

Recently, Pam moved to Eugene to be close to her grandsons and to be able to be outdoors more. She is excited to be using her skills and knowledge to begin a pediatric physical therapy program at Therapeutic Associates and working with orthopedic conditions. Pam has always had a passion for physical therapy, but she especially enjoys helping and teaching children and families.

Pam enjoys any connection with nature and has been very happy in Oregon. She especially likes exploring with her grandsons and her husband. In her spare time she likes to hike, quilt, travel, and read.
